http://www.mdislander.com/opinions/lyme-disease-is-only-getting-worse If untreated or insufficiently treated, typical symptoms include fatigue, inflammation, sensitivity to sound and light, nerve pain and numbness, sleep and digestive disorders, hormone disruption, anxiety and depression, and heart issues. People can die from Lyme carditis. Lyme in the brain can cause cognitive and psychological problems; I know from experience. The Social Security Disability examiner noted I was “severely cognitively impaired” five years ago, especially with short-term memory and difficulty speaking fluently. Called “The Great Imitator,” Lyme can be misdiagnosed as Alzheimer’s, Arthritis, Chronic Fatigue, Fibromyalgia, Bi-polar, Lupus, Crohn’s disease, Autism and more.
